Dormansland offers a unique blend of rural charm and convenient transport links, making it an attractive option for shared ownership buyers. The village sits within the Tandridge district of Surrey, approximately 4 miles from Lingfield and within easy reach of East Grinstead and Crawley. Property values in the area have shown steady growth, with average prices around £537,000-£564,000 depending on the source consulted. Our valuer will visit your property at the agreed time, conducting a comprehensive internal and external survey. They'll photograph the property, measure rooms, note any improvements or defects, and assess features that affect value. The inspection typically takes 30-60 minutes depending on the size of your Dormansland home.

The Beacon Platt development on High Street, which received planning permission in January 2025 for four new semi-detached dwellings, represents the ongoing development activity in Dormansland. Our valuers stay informed about such developments and understand how new build activity affects the wider property market in the area. Additionally, the planning permission for 9 dwellings at the former Dormans Station site demonstrates continued developer interest in the village, which can influence property values across the local area.

Shared ownership provides an accessible route onto the property ladder in areas like Dormansland, where property prices have risen substantially over the years. The average house price in Dormansland now exceeds £537,000, making full ownership challenging for many first-time buyers. Shared ownership allows you to purchase a share typically between 25% and 75% of the property's value, paying rent on the remaining share to a housing association. This model has helped many families secure their own home in this attractive Surrey village.

A shared ownership valuation is a professional assessment of your property's current market value conducted by a RICS registered valuer. This valuation is specifically required when staircasing (buying additional shares), remortgaging your shared ownership property, or at the end of your lease. The report provides an independent, professionally recognised figure that all parties can rely on for transaction purposes. You do not need to vacate the property, but we do require access to all rooms including any loft space and accessible storage areas. Our valuer will need to take photographs and measurements to include in the RICS-compliant report. If you cannot be present, we can arrange for a trusted person to provide access on your behalf. For shared ownership properties, it's helpful if you can provide documentation relating to your lease terms, service charges, and any improvements you've made to the property.
If you believe the valuation is incorrect, you can request a review from our team with additional supporting evidence such as recent comparable sales or details of any improvements made to the property. For staircasing transactions, the housing association may also commission their own valuation, and in some cases, an independent arbitrator can be appointed to resolve significant disputes. You typically need a fresh valuation whenever you staircase (buy additional shares), remortgage your property, or reach a trigger point specified in your lease. Housing associations may also request a valuation at certain intervals or when service charges are disputed.
